We are looking for a Registered Nurse to join our team to support a major manufacturer in Montgomery, AL. This role will be part of an onsite health clinic, providing occupational health and injury prevention services to employees. What will you be doing in this role?
Provide medical care and treatment for work-related injuries and illnesses
Conduct injury and illness case management, including return-to-work coordination and disability accommodations
Perform and manage occupational health screenings such as audiograms, drug screenings, and respirator fit testing
Support ergonomic assessments and safety coaching to promote workplace safety
Collaborate with the Health & Safety team and provide health education/coaching (e.g., Lunch and Learns)
Maintain and manage electronic medical records (EMR) and occupational health data systems
Participate in campus wellness events and environmental health and safety meetings
Support First Aid/CPR training and AED inspections

Our ideal candidate will have:
Bachelor’s degree in Nursing or equivalent for a Registered Nurse
The required state licensure, certification, and registration that is in good standing with the state or the ability to obtain the required state licensure
CPR/AED/BLS (basic life support) certification or the ability to obtain it prior to start of employment; maintain and provide proof of current certification(s)
Greater than one-year work experience, specifically in an occupational health setting
Knowledge and experience with Electronic Medical Records
The ability to stand, walk, and sit throughout entire assigned shift
A high degree of professionalism in both written and verbal communication
The ability to work both independently and in a team environment, without constant supervision
Be able to maintain confidentiality
Strong computer skills, including proficiency with databases and with Microsoft Office applications, including Outlook, Word, PowerPoint, and Excel
